Course contents:
Prepare and presenting a poster at an international conference with more that 30 participants
Learning outcome:

After completion the PhD-candidate demonstrated ability to present own scientific work on a poster and in a poster session for an international conference audience with over 30 participants.

The candidate will learn to

  • Present own results in a poster-format
  • Edit and shorten long texts without losing content
  • Become comfortable with editorial presentation programs 
  • Explain and discuss the poster with a variable audience of passing-by unknown scientists and be able to improvise and hypothesize
Learning activities:
To prepare and present a scientific poster based on one's own research at an international conference.
